Abstract
OBJECTIVES: This study aimed to evaluate the etiology, outcomes and prognostic factors associated with status epilepticus (SE) admissions in Neurology Department of a tertiary care hospital.Entities:
Keywords: Morbidity; Mortality; Prognostic factors; Refractory; Status epilepticus; Super-refractory

Provocative factors associated with onset of status epilepticus.
| Provocative Factor | Frequency n (%)(n=176) | Morbidity n (%)(n =44) | Mortality n (%)(n=22)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Noncompliant to Meds/ Under-dosed | 68 (38.6) | 8 (18.2) | 5( 22.7) |
| Infective etiology | 55 (31.3) | 12 (27.2) | 12 (54.5) |
| Unprovoked | 20 (11.3) | 8(18.8) | 1 (4.5) |
| Vascular event | 15 (8.5) | 9 (20.4) | 1 (4.5) |
| Metabolic derangement | 12 (6.8) | 5 (11.3) | 2 (9.0) |
| Immune-mediated | 4 (2.2) | 1 (2.2) | 0 (0.0) |
| Trauma | 1 (0.6) | 0 (0.0) | 1 (4.5) |
| Tumor | 1 (0.6) | 1 (2.2) | 0 (0.0) |
